Produktbeschreibung
The art was meant to stay on the walls. But no one told them... When art appraiser Anita Cassatt is sent to catalogue the extensive collection of reclusive artist Leo Kubin, it isn't the chill of the secluded house making her shiver, it's the silent audience of portraits clustered on every wall, watching her. The lawyer didn't share the dead artist's instructions for handling his art, and Anita and her team start work ignorant of the instructions designed to keep them safe. Safe from the art. There are secrets hiding in Kubin's house. But as Anita and her team discover, some secrets don't want to stay hidden. Described as Caravaggio meets Poltergeist - Painted is a gothic ghost novel with a decent serving of psychological unease and a healthy fear of the dark. Perfect for lovers of Shirley Jackson's The Haunting of Hill House. Just imagine the Antiques Roadshow, if Stephen King was the host...
Autorenporträt
A full time author, Kirsten is a former customs officer and antiques dealer, and who has also dabbled in film and television. Her historical time-slip series - The Old Curiosity Shop Series (which includes Fifteen Postcards, The Last Letter and Telegram Home), has been described as 'Time Travellers Wife meets Far Pavilions', and 'Antiques Roadshow gone viral'. Kirsten released her bestselling gothic horror novel Painted in 2017, with her medical thriller - Doctor Perry, following in 2018. Both books hit #1 in the Canadian and Australian horror charts. Her latest thriller - The Forger and the Thief, was released in July 2020. Set in Florence, Italy. Kirsten lives in New Zealand with her husband, her daughters, two rescue cats.
